IWL: Odisha FC sign Faustina Worwornyo Akpo
The player is a former Ghana U-20 International.
Odisha FC is delighted to announce the signing of Faustina Worwornyo Akpo, the former Ghana U-20 International for the upcoming season of the Indian Women’s League. Faustina joins us after a successful season with Al-Naser Women in the Jordan Women's League, where she proved herself to be a prolific and talented goal scorer.
